home *** CD-ROM | disk | FTP | other *** search
/ Developer CD Series 1999 …ember: Reference Library / Apple Developer Reference Library (December 1999) (Disk 1).iso / pc / technical documentation / develop / develop issue 28 / develop issue 28 code / sketch / source / main / imaging.h < prev    next >
Encoding:
Text File  |  1996-08-04  |  1.1 KB  |  25 lines

  1. // Imaging.h
  2.  
  3.  
  4. #include "Structs.h"
  5.  
  6. // -------------------------------------------------------------------
  7.  
  8. void IMDraw                        (DocumentReference document);
  9. void IMDelete                    (DocumentReference document, ElementReference element);
  10.  
  11. void ResizeElementData            (DocumentReference document, ElementReference element, Rect newBounds);
  12.  
  13. void ResizeOpenEndedObject        (DocumentReference document, ElementReference element, Rect newBounds);
  14. void ResizeClosedObject            (DocumentReference document, ElementReference element, Rect newBounds);
  15. void ResizePolygon                (DocumentReference document, ElementReference element, Rect newBounds);
  16. void ResizeGroup                (DocumentReference document, ElementReference element, Rect newBounds);
  17.  
  18. // -----------------------------------------------------------------------------------------
  19.  
  20. void MoveElementData            (DocumentReference document, ElementReference element, short newTop, short newLeft);
  21. void OffsetElementData            (DocumentReference document, ElementReference element, short deltaH, short deltaV);
  22.  
  23. // -----------------------------------------------------------------------------------------
  24.  
  25.